The Indian Minerals Yearbook 2020 provides an overview of lead and zinc resources in India, highlighting that lead is primarily used in lead-acid batteries while zinc is mainly used in galvanizing. As of April 2015, the total reserves/resources of lead and zinc ore were estimated at 749.46 million tonnes, with Rajasthan holding the largest share. The document also discusses the production and recycling of lead, emphasizing the importance of lead scrap recycling in meeting the increasing demand.
